The 12,000 lb. winch is big enough to let us mount the solenoid right to the winch itself. And when you pair it with our winch receiver mount, you get a winch you can move between vehicles with ease.
The winch bolts onto the mount, and the mount attaches to any 2” receiver hitch. Once you have the winch mounted and wired, you can easily move it between vehicles. Taking your Jeep to an overlanding rock trail? Plug it in there. Taking your side-by-side to the mud park tomorrow? Pop it off your Jeep and slip it onto your UTV.
It’s a portable truck winch, Jeep winch, and UTV winch. Use it where you need it, when you need it.

That’s because our winch uses a quick disconnect winch power cable. You run it to your battery terminals once, and then you can plug and unplug it easily.
The main power isn’t the only thing that plugs in fast. The key-on power wire uses a quick-disconnect plug too. And the wired remote plugs right into a socket on the solenoid itself. Getting up and running when you switch it to another vehicle is three-plugs-and-done.
It truly is a portable winch you can use on all your vehicles.
